Step 1: Dive into the My.SSS Portal
First things first, you'll need to brave the digital wilderness of the My.SSS Portal. Don't worry, it's not as scary as it sounds. Just head over to https://www.sss.gov.ph/ and log in with your trusty SSS number and password.
Step 2: The Great "Member Inquiry" Quest
Once you're logged in, channel your inner Indiana Jones and embark on a quest to find the "Member Inquiry" section. It might be hidden amongst a maze of menus and buttons, but persevere, brave adventurer!
Step 3: Behold! The Loan Status Tracker
Within the "Member Inquiry" section, you'll finally find the holy grail: the Loan Status Tracker. This is where the magic happens, folks. Just select "Pension Loan" from the loan type dropdown menu and enter your application reference number.
Step 4: The Big Reveal (Hopefully Not a Cliffhanger)
Hit that "Submit" button and hold your breath (or take a sip of your favorite beverage, we don't judge). The screen will then reveal the fate of your loan application, displayed in all its glory (or lack thereof).
Possible Endings (choose your own adventure):
- "Application Approved" - You did it! Time to celebrate (responsibly, of course)!
- "Application Still Pending" - Patience, grasshopper. The loan officers are probably wading through a sea of paperwork.
- "Application Rejected" - Don't despair! Check the reason for rejection and see if you can rectify the situation.
Remember:
- This is just a guide, and the actual interface might differ slightly.
- If you encounter any difficulties, don't hesitate to contact the SSS hotline (1455) or visit their nearest branch. They're there to help, even if they might sound a little busy sometimes.
